Comprehensive Climate Action Plan
The second deliverable of the Climate Pollution Reduction Grant planning program is the Comprehensive Climate Action Plan (CCAP). DEQ submitted the CCAP to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) in December 2025.
The CCAP builds upon the Priority Climate Action Plan (PCAP) and updates and expands upon North Carolina’s existing climate strategies, ensuring that these planning documents align with the latest available science, modeling, and best practices. This plan aligns with existing goals and requirements for reducing GHG emissions and increasing clean energy solutions. This plan covers all source sectors identified in the PCAP.
The CCAP planning document contains current and projected GHG emissions levels and benefits.
Public and Stakeholder Engagement
Throughout 2025, DEQ conducted stakeholder and public engagement to gain public input on existing community climate strategies and new greenhouse gas reduction initiatives, projects, or project ideas developed since the PCAP. Public feedback helped DEQ determine the program's direction, priorities, and future projects.
After drafting the CCAP, DEQ opened a formal public comment period regarding the draft Plan in August 2025.
- Feb. - March 2024: DEQ solicited input on existing community climate strategies as well as new initiatives, projects or project ideas related to greenhouse gases developed since the PCAP.
- Sept. - Nov. 2025: DEQ accepted public comment on North Carolina's Draft Comprehensive Climate Action Plan (CCAP). Comments and feedback were considered as DEQ developed the Draft Comprehensive Climate Action Plan.
- December 2025: DEQ released the Comprehensive Climate Action Plan (CCAP).
